Recklinghausen is a city located in the North Rhine-Westphalia region of Germany. Known for its rich history and cultural heritage, Recklinghausen offers visitors a blend of traditional charm and modern amenities.

History

The history of Recklinghausen dates back to the 9th century when it was first mentioned in historical records. Over the centuries, the city has played a significant role in the region's development, serving as a key trading hub and administrative center.

Attractions

Visitors to Recklinghausen can enjoy a range of attractions, including the Icon Museum, which houses a collection of religious art, and the Vestisches Museum, which showcases the history of the region. The Stadtgarten park offers a relaxing green space for visitors to unwind and enjoy nature.

Outdoor Activities

For those who enjoy the outdoors, Recklinghausen offers a range of activities, including hiking and cycling trails in the surrounding countryside. The nearby Halde Hoheward park is a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ts, offering panoramic views of the city and surrounding area.
